Phreesia, a leading healthcare payment and engagement platform, recently held its first-quarter earnings call. Management highlighted operational progress and strategic initiatives, though specific financial details from the call were limited. The company’s performance in the quarter may reflect broader trends in digital health adoption.

During the Q1 earnings call, Phreesia’s leadership discussed the company’s recent performance and future outlook. While exact revenue and earnings figures were not provided in the available summary, the call typically covers key operational metrics such as client growth, payment transaction volumes, and new product adoption. Phreesia has been expanding its suite of patient engagement tools, which could support continued momentum in the healthcare technology sector. The company’s focus on streamlining administrative workflows for providers and enhancing patient payment experiences remains central to its strategy. Management likely addressed the impact of seasonal factors and pricing adjustments on quarterly results, as well as any changes to guidance for the remainder of the fiscal year. No specific forward-looking statements were confirmed in the available highlights. Key takeaways from the call may include Phreesia’s continued client acquisition and retention efforts, which are critical for recurring revenue growth. The company operates in a competitive market for healthcare SaaS, where interoperability and ease of integration are important differentiators. Phreesia’s platform helps reduce administrative burden, and any updates on product enhancements or new partnerships could signal growth potential. Investors may focus on cash flow trends and the path to profitability, as many healthcare tech firms prioritize scaling over near-term profits. The earnings call could also have addressed regulatory tailwinds or headwinds affecting the industry, such as changes in healthcare reimbursement models or data privacy requirements. Overall, the call likely reinforced Phreesia’s positioning as a key player in the digital health infrastructure space. From an investment perspective, Phreesia’s Q1 call suggests the company remains on a trajectory of gradual improvement in operational metrics. The broader market for healthcare technology may continue to expand as providers seek efficiency solutions, potentially benefiting Phreesia. However, the company faces risks such as customer concentration, competition from larger healthcare IT firms, and macroeconomic pressures on healthcare spending. Without specific revenue or earnings data, investors should rely on official filings for detailed financial updates. The earnings call highlights provide only a partial view, and any investment decisions should be based on comprehensive analysis. As with all such events, market reactions could vary based on interpretation of management’s tone and strategic comments.
